Lost in Jamaica: Scarlett Johansson heads on holiday to escape divorce drama

A day after announcing the end of her two-year marriage to Ryan Reynolds, a tense-looking Scarlett Johansson was spotted in Jamaica on Thursday with a group of friends.

The 26-year-old allegedly initiated the split from Ryan, 34, after the stress of being apart all the time became too much for her to take.

And now it looks as if she is escaping the divorce drama by laying low on the Caribbean island to regroup and and get some support from her pals.

Wearing a white fedora, blue shorts and a grey tank top over a yellow bikini, the actress looked sombre and subdued as she carried a copy of Vanity Fair with Johnny Depp on the cover.

Scarlett and Ryan released a statement on Wednesday saying: ‘After long and careful consideration on both our parts, we’ve decided to end our marriage.

‘We entered our relationship with love and it’s with love and kindness we leave it. While privacy isn’t expected, it’s certainly appreciated.’

Simon Cowell jets to Barbados with ex Sinitta… but fiancée stays at home

She recently insisted they were still very much an item in the wake of persistent rumours they had split. But in another apparent blow to their relationship, Simon Cowell has jetted off on holiday to Barbados — without his fiancée Mezhgan Hussainy. Instead, the music mogul has brought along ex-girlfriend Sinitta for company, who he is still famously friendly with. Mezhgan, 37, meanwhile, is believed to be staying at the millionaire’s London mansion. She joined Cowell at the weekend for the X Factor finals, with Sinitta, 42, and another one of his exes Terri Seymour, 36, also seen at the show’s London studios. Last month make-up artist Mezhgan spoke out to deny reports they had gone their separate ways. “I still love him and he says he still loves me and we are still engaged — as far as I know,” she said. Meanwhile X Factor supremo Cowell has already deployed his lawyers to warn photographers to give him privacy while lapping up the Caribbean sun. The 51-year-old TV star is also said to have been stung for £100 in duty charges to bring a stack of his favourite beers on holiday.

Reality star Kimora Lee Simmons enjoys a romantic date with her husband

She’s a reality star, mother-of-three, and CEO of a fashion empire, but Kimora Lee Simmons still finds time for romance. The 35-year-old joined her partner, Oscar-nominated actor Djimon Hounsou, for an adults-only lunch at famed Beverly Hills eatery Il Pastaio on Wednesday. The relaxed-looking couple walked arm in arm out of the restaurant and waited patiently for their car in the valet area after lunch. Kimora, who is six-feet-tall, was affectionate with Djimon, her partner of three years, leaning in and giving him kisses as they talked. The couple, who began dating in 2007, never officially married but took part in a traditional African commitment ceremony in the summer of 2008. They have a son together, 18-month-old Kenzo Lee and Kimora also has two daughters from her marriage to Phat Farm and Def Jam creator Russell Simmons. The entrepreneur and former model will be enjoying the time she gets with her beau over the festive period before he heads off on the international promotional tour for his new film The Tempest. Kimora, meanwhile, is busy with Baby Phat and her high-end fashion line KLS, as well as the upcoming new season of her reality show, Kimora: Life in The Fab Lane.

Boys and their bikes: George Clooney joins a friend for lunch and a ride

George Clooney indulged in his other passion on Thursday and dusted off his favourite motorcycle. The actor joined his actor-director friend Grant Heslov for a boys-only lunch at the Chateau Marmont Hotel before heading out for a ride through West Hollywood.

The 49-year-old ER star has been a huge motorcycle fan for years keeping bikes at his home in Los Angeles and villa on Lake Como in Italy. His particular bike is a custom-made Harley Davidson which is worth around US$24,000. George looked relaxed and happy wearing a simple white shirt and jeans combo as the two men cruised down Sunset Boulevard on their matching bikes. George and Grant, 47, have been friends for years and worked on several films together including Leatherheads, Intolerable Cruelty, Men Who Stare At Goats and most recentlyThe American on which both men were producers, while George also took on the male lead role.
